Description
Top of card has two holes where it would be on a spindle for viewing. Each side of card has smaller holes with different color yarn displayed, number of color by hole. There are 59 colors on the card.*Printed middle of card, black ink: "BERNAT'S / SHETLAND WOOL / An ideal knitting yarn; also adapted for wearing as warp or weft. It will not break on the loom and is good in scarves, dress fabrics, coverlets, and countless other products. / It is supplied in the colors on this card, comes in two ounce skeins, and the yardage in a pound is two thousand. We are always glad to supply the yarn by the skein or pound. / FAST COLORS / This is a Bernat "Weavrite" Yarn / The Shuttle-Craft Co., Inc. / 14 Ash Street / Cambridge, Mass."
